Reccer's Notes:
I don't know where to start on this. I can't think of another series I've ever become so obsessive about, including pro fic. It is poly done exceptionally well, sexy and character-focused. None of the characters are great at emotional intimacy, and sometimes they're not particularly consistent, and jealousy and selfishness and desire all make appearances. They care about one another and don't want to hurt each other, but they don't always know how to do that. But mostly, they're trying to figure out how to fit around one another, while also dealing with all the shit that is involved in being Pegasus residents. The other highlight of this story for me is Ronon's characterisation and backstory, and the obvious fondness he has for Rodney.
